Using Image Editing Software
If you prefer using image editing software, there are several options available that can help you convert JPG to BMP without losing quality. Here are a few popular image editing software and the steps to follow:

2. GIMP: GIMP is a free and open-source image editing software that can be used to convert JPG to BMP. Open the JPG image, go to “File” > “Export As,” and select BMP as the file format.
3. Paint.NET: This free image editing software is suitable for beginners. Open the JPG image, go to “File” > “Save As,” and select BMP as the file format.
Using Command Line Tools
For advanced users, command line tools can be a great way to convert JPG to BMP without losing quality. One of the most popular command line tools for this purpose is ImageMagick. Here’s how to use it:
1. Install ImageMagick on your computer.
2. Open the Command Prompt or Terminal.
3. Navigate to the directory where your JPG image is located.
4. Type the following command: `convert image.jpg image.bmp`
5. Press Enter, and the conversion process will begin.
